This Conservative Pundit Just Picked Up a Show on HLN

Conservative political commentator S.E. Cupp, who has been a CNN regular, has landed a nightly program on CNN’s sister network, HLN, executive vice president Ken Jautz announced on Monday.

“This is the next step in our campaign to bolster our primetime lineup. You can expect to see S.E. lend her energy and insights to conversations with provocative guests from the diverse worlds of radio, politics, comedy and journalism as she tackles the day’s most important stories,” Jautz said in a statement.

The soon-to-be-named show will launch in early June and air from New York.

Other HLN Originals Series premiering this year include “Beyond Reasonable Doubt,” “Something’s Killing Me” and “Inside Secret Places with Chris Cuomo.”
